Warning Signs of a guaranteed Win Scam: Protect Yourself From Fraudsters
When it comes to making money online, be wary of offers that sound too good to be true. Con artists are constantly looking for new ways to trick people into giving up their hard-earned cash. A guaranteed win scam is a particularly dangerous type of scheme, as it preys on your desire to get rich quickly. If someone promises you guaranteed profits with minimal effort, there's a high chance you're dealing with a scheme.
- Be cautious of websites that advertise unrealistic returns on investment.
- Look into the company or individual making the promise thoroughly before investing any money.
- Never provide personal information, such as your bank account details, to someone you don't believe.
- Report any suspicious activity to the appropriate authorities.
Remember, if something sounds too good to be true, it probably is. Stay informed and protect yourself from falling victim to these scams.
